The transfer of drugs with the mother into the nursing infant from the mom’s milk could manifest with several drugs, Together with the drug effects manifesting during the infant. For the duration of lactation, morphine and tetracycline are averted given that they are excreted by way of milk and consequences babies.

Precautions are used to suggest the prescriber of some attainable troubles attendant with the usage of the drug. It's less restrictive than a warning. Ex: The use of tetracycline antibiotics may possibly result in the overgrowth of fungi. In this type of situation, the physician may possibly prescribe an alternate drug.

Bioavailability from the drug modifications as route of administration modifications. Drugs administered by intravenous (IV) route tend to be more bioavailable than that of orally administered drugs.

Drugs could be cleared during the kidneys by passive filtration within the glomerulus or secretion in the tubules, complex by reabsorption in certain compounds.     

Pharmacokinetics, as a discipline, makes an attempt to summarize the movement of drugs through the human body plus the steps of the body within the drug. By making use of the above mentioned conditions, theories, and equations, practitioners can better estimate the places and concentrations of the drug in various parts of the body.

A dosage routine aims to determine a concentrate on plasma focus that features a maximal therapeutic effect and also the least toxicity. To take action, a plot of a drug plasma focus compared to time is utilized to establish a therapeutic window all through which the drug dosage is Harmless and productive.

Absorption is the process that brings a drug from the administration, eg, pill or capsule, in the systemic circulation. Absorption affects the pace and concentration at which a drug may perhaps get there at its wished-for spot of impact, eg, plasma.
